Bruce Pearl Named SEC Coach of the Year

AUBURN, ALABAMA (EETV)- Head coach Bruce Pearl was named the SEC Coach of the Year after leading Auburn to its first outright SEC Regular Season Title since 1999. Pearl earned this award when the Southeastern Conference released their annual awards list on Tuesday.

Tigers Combine For No-Hitter

AUBURN, ALABAMA. (EETV) - Auburn Softball started off it's Friday doubleheader by throwing a combined no-hitter against North Carolina A&T. Maddie Penta got the start and faced the first 15 batters before KK Dismukes finished the game. The win moves Auburn to 17-1 on the season and 11-1 at home.

Auburn Baseball Hosts Rhode Island For a Four Game Series

AUBURN, ALABAMA (EETV)- Auburn baseball is set to welcome Rhode Island for a four game series this week inside Plainsman Park. This four game series will mark six games in six days for the Tigers. Auburn and Rhode Island are slated for games on Friday, a double-header on Saturday and the two will close out the series on Sunday.

Aicha Coulibaly Named All-SEC Second Team

AUBURN, ALABAMA (EETV)- Aicha Coulibaly was named to the All-SEC Second Team when the league office announced the annual women's basketball awards on Tuesday. Coulibaly was the only Auburn player on any of the award lists.

Auburn Softball's Makayla Packer Named Co-SEC Player of the Week

AUBURN, ALABAMA (EETV)- Makayla Packer received her first Southeastern Conference Co-Player of the Week honor following an impressive performance at the plate in the past six games for the Tigers. Packer shares this week's title with Missouri’s Casidy Chaumont, and is the first Auburn player to receive this honor since Alyssa Rivera on March 2, 2020.
